Background of Flutterwave

Flutterwave is a Nigerian fintech company founded in 2016 by Iyinoluwa Aboyeji and Olugbenga Agboola. The company provides payment infrastructure for global merchants and payment service providers in Africa. Flutterwave’s mission is to simplify payments for endless possibilities, and they aim to achieve this by building a payments technology infrastructure that connects Africa to the global economy.

Flutterwave has raised over $225 million in funding from investors such as Mastercard, Visa, and Fintech Collective. The company has also partnered with several banks and payment providers to enable seamless transactions across multiple African countries.

Flutterwave’s payment infrastructure includes APIs for processing payments, a virtual card service, and a mobile POS solution. The company’s flagship product, Rave, is a payments gateway that enables merchants to accept payments from multiple sources, including credit cards, bank accounts, and mobile money wallets.

Flutterwave has been recognized for its innovative solutions and has won several awards, including the Best Fintech Solution at the 2021 AppsAfrica Awards. The company has also been featured in global publications such as Forbes, TechCrunch, and Bloomberg.
